uPVC windows can have problems opening or locking.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ism becomes stiff or jammed. If this is the case, a quick solution is to use graphite powder or machine oil to lubricate the handle and lock mechanism. This will allow the lock mechanism to be unlocked and the door or window to function normally once again.
Another issue that often arises with uPVC windows is that the hinges become stiff or even stuck. This issue is typically caused by grit and dust accumulating on the hinges over time. The solution is to lubricate the hinges using grease or oil. The wrong lubricant can damage the hinges and make them inoperable.

Repairs to stained glass
Stained glass windows are located in homes, churches and other buildings. They add visual interest and add privacy to a space. They can be fragile and require careful maintenance to ensure they remain in good condition. Even with the most careful maintenance, stained glass and leaded windows will deteriorate due to age as well as exposure to the elements and weather elements. This can lead to cracks, fade, and water leakage. It is important to find an expert in your area to restore your stained or leaded window back to its original splendor.
On average, the cost for fixing broken or cracked stained glass is about $500. The cost will vary depending on the solution required to fix the issue. For example, a professional may use cop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ing to fix the broken glass. They can also relead lead cames and seal stained glass. There are several options, each having their own pros and cons. The best choice is based on the size, location, and type of glass used.
Leaded glass cracks could be caused by vibrations, thermal expansion or contraction building movements, or normal wear and tear. The cracks can enlarge and create larger problems as time passes. To avoid further damage and expansion any crack that crosses the face of stained-glass panels or their face must be fixed as fast as possible. In the past, this was accomplished by cutting a "Dutchman's" lead flange over the crack. This was not a good solution, and today there are more effective methods to repair these kinds of cracks.
Stained glass restoration is a specific art that can take many forms. It could be as simple as repairing cracks, or as complex as restoring an entire stained glass window or door panel to its original form. Generally speaking, the price of a restoration project is considerably higher than an easy repair or replacement. The work includes cleaning and removing damaged glass, tightening lead cames, resealing the cement and re-tying, and replacing stained glass pieces that are missing.
Weatherstripping Repairs
Weatherstripping prevents water and air from coming into homes through the gaps between doors and windows. It is an essential aspect of home maintenance that can save money on cost of energy and costly repairs. It also makes homes more comfortable. However, the materials used to make this seal will degrade over time due to wear and tear, making it important to replace them regularly.

Taskers can protect your doors and windows by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made from closed or open-cell foam and are available in a variety of thicknesses, widths, and specifications to suit every kind of crack. They are easy to install and cut with scissors. Felt strips are likewise inexpensive and last for a year or two. They can be cut into length using scissors and glued to the frame of a door or hinge side of a double glazed window repairs-hung or sliding window using staples, glue or tacks. Metal or vinyl V-strips are somewhat more difficult to put in place however they can be nailed in the window jamb.
